21 /*
22  * This file includes implementation of UBI character device operations.
23  *
24  * There are two kinds of character devices in UBI: UBI character devices and
25  * UBI volume character devices. UBI character devices allow users to
26  * manipulate whole volumes: create, remove, and re-size them. Volume character
27  * devices provide volume I/O capabilities.
28  *
29  * Major and minor numbers are assigned dynamically to both UBI and volume
30  * character devices.
31  *
32  * Well, there is the third kind of character devices - the UBI control
33  * character device, which allows to manipulate by UBI devices - create and
34  * delete them. In other words, it is used for attaching and detaching MTD
35  * devices.
36  */
